Maybe this will help you out on your permit renewal. I put in my renewal on Feb 4. for the three year renewal. I asked about the new five year renewal and they hadn't heard anything about the Governor signing it yet.
The next week the Prothonotary's office called and said the Governor signed the law on Feb. 3 and anyone filing for renewal from the 3rd on would be eligible for the five year renewal if they wanted to send in the additional $30.50
or I could leave it at the three year for the 34.50 already paid.
